ANNAPOLIS, Md. — The COVID-19 pandemic has made it difficult for Maryland residents to keep up with state vehicle requirements.

Now the MVA has made it so drivers can look up all notices, letters and receipts related to their vehicle online.

All you have to do is go to View My MDOT MVA Correspondence under the website’s Online Services tab, and enter your tag or title number, driver’s license number and last four digits of your Social Security number.

That will show you everything you need to know about your vehicle's status since July of last year.

Everything listed below would be included in the updated information.

  • Tag Return Receipt,
  • VEIP Inspection Notice,
  • Flag Notice,
  • Insurance Suspension Notice,
  • Change of Address Card,
  • 15-Day Temporary Registration, and
  • Updated Vehicle Registration Renewal.

In December, the MVA is looking to give customers access to information on driver’s license renewal notices.
